Also, is there a removal tool to fully remove Pidgen? I tried
uninstalling and re-installing however I picks up my old accounts.
Uninstalling Microsoft Word shouldn't delete all your Word documents,
should it? Pidgin's uninstaller behaves fine here. If you want your
settings (and logs!) deleted, then do so yourself. Their location is
covered in the FAQ.

Putting an "Also remove settings" option into the unistaller would
solve the problem easily.


If a user wants to remove his or her settings, there's only a ".purple" directory to delete in the user's App Data folder. If there were settings scattered throughout the registry or different locations on the filesystem, I might see a valid argument, but in general I don't think it's wise to automatically remove settings, or anything the installer didn't create, even optionally.
